The proposal is forwarding multiple messages to multiple destinations at the same time. The mobiles have the facility to forward a single message to multiple destinations. The messages can be forwarded using the push approach and the Mobile Agent Client and Mobile Agent Server. Since a mobile agent has certain properties which supports multiple message forwarding but affects the reliability certainly, mobile agents for sub servers can be a substitute as well. Messages will be selected in an order and the recipients’ numbers are be added. Once the sender toggles the option of ‘send’, the multiple messages selected must be sent to the recipients in the order they are selected to send. It can either be based on the messages like one by one message must first be sent to the recipients thus all the messages selected reaches the recipient 1 then all the messages will be sent to the next recipient 2 and so on or message 1 is sent to all the recipients and message 2 is sent to all the recipients and so on. Gateways in Mobile Agent Server can be used for the store and forward technique. If the network is busy and any message is not received by any of the recipient then the Mobile Agent Server will locate the address from the MA Client and establish connectivity again and then forwards the message.

INTRODUCTION

Mobile Agents are autonomous objects which enable movement between locations in the MA system. Mobile Agents have a great potential in the distributed network architecture as they provide structuring of the distributed systems and applications. These Agents enable sharing of information, cooperative work between MA systems, search and filter selective information, share work and partial results and gather information required to perform their tasks completely. In a Mobile Agent Platform (MAP) all the senders and recipients will be involved and the Mobile Agent Server will perform connectivity with the Mobile Agent Client using a concept of Gateway to enhance the performance of forwarding multiple messages to multiple destinations [1][2]. Mobile Agent Server will hold all the details of Clients and proceed to forwarding of messages [1][2][5]
